SCU Men’s Tennis Selected to Play in the ITA Kick-Off Weekend Event

SANTA CLARA, Calif. – The Santa Clara University men's tennis team was drafted to play in the 2012 Intercollegiate Tennis Association (ITA) Kick-Off Weekend event, which features the nation's top programs. Santa Clara, ranked No. 49 nationally, is scheduled to face No. 52 Boise State and either No. 7 Stanford or No. 61 St. Mary's at the Taube Family Tennis Stadium in Stanford.

The tournament will take place January 27-30, 2012, with winners of each site advancing to the ITA National Team Indoor Championships Feb. 17-20 in Charlottesville, Va. at the Boar's Head Sports Club (hosted by the University of Virginia).

The ITA Kick-Off Weekend includes 60 total schools spanning 15 sites. The No. 1 seeded team in each site will face the No. 4 team. The No. 2 seeded team will face the No. 3 team. Two matches are guaranteed - the winners/losers will play the following day. The 15 schools that win both of their matches at these events will be invited to Charlottesville.

This is the second-straight year the Broncos have been drafted to play in the event.

"We are proud to be among the top 60 teams in the nation and play at the ITA Kick-Off Weekend," said SCU men's tennis head coach Derek Mills, who guided the Broncos to a No. 2 finish at the West Coast Conference Championships this Spring.

"Our goal is to be ranked inside of the top 25 next season. With us being the second-seed in this event, we will play a tough first-round match against Boise State. Playing top teams on the national stage will be exciting and will also be a great opportunity for our players."
